Assessment of radial errors of high speed spindle in a miniaturized machine tool(Nano/micro measurement and intelligent instrument)

Abstract
To separate the errors in rotating spindle, multi-step and multi-probe methods have been developed. However, few researches were reported on high RPM cases. In this paper, an efficient method to analyze the radial errors of high speed spindle in a miniaturized machine tool is proposed. Different speed cases for the spindle are investigated. Firstly, eccentricity error is removed using coordinate transformation. Later, the roundness and spindle errors are separated based on the cut off frequency of a filter used in the present algorithm. The method is effective in determining and analyzing the spindle errors of a high speed miniaturized machine tool.
